Christening Cup

Artifact IDMO 99.6a
Object Type Cup
Date 1845
Medium niello, silver
DimensionsOverall H 2 3/4 in x W 2 3/4 in (7 cm x 7 cm )

Physical DescriptionBeaker shaped cup, with a flat bottom and flared lip. The cup is engraved with a band of foliate decoration running all the way around. The band is punctuated by two scenes within circles opposite each other, one is engraved with an image of the Winter Palace and the other the Summer Palace. The rim of the cup is engraved "Micheline Pitt From Your Godmother Kathleen Hartington."
Historical NoteThis cup was given to Tayna Pitt Dobbs, who donated it to the JFK Library, by Kathleen Kennedy Hartington when they were stationed together working for the American Red Cross in London. It was originally given to the Duke and Duchess of Devonshire at the christening of their son, William Hartington, by the Czar of Russia.
